“Hi I’m Doctor Savage I’m here to discuss how toxic shock syndrome is spread. First toxic shock syndrome happens because of either an infection or foreign body with bacteria occurs either in the throat, in the skin, or for females in the vagina. These certain bacteria secrete toxins, one of the most commonly known toxic shock syndrome toxin causes a body wide inflammatory response. In which this, these what is called cytokines which cause diffuse inflammation causes leaking of the fluids outside of your blood vessels and into extra cellular spaces. So you have generally swelling and at the same time, your blood pressure goes down because the volume inside of your blood vessels go down. The other thing that happens is these bacteria secrete what’s called super antigens, it’s another type of toxin in which these antigens cause an immune response to these toxins.
